Embrace the Chill with Epic Tabletop TournamentsWhen the winter wind howls outside, nothing matches the warmth of a lively, competitive tabletop tournament. To elevate a standard board game night into an unforgettable seasonal event, structure your evening around a bracket-style competition. Choose games that are easy to learn but difficult to master, ensuring that guests of all skill levels can participate right away. Fast-paced card games, dexterity games like Jenga, or classic strategy games work beautifully for this format. You can set up multiple “stations” around your living space to keep everyone engaged simultaneously.To enhance the tournament atmosphere, create a large, visible bracket on a whiteboard or poster. Introduce small, humorous prizes for the winners, such as a custom-decorated winter mug or a golden dice trophy. For players who get eliminated early, establish a secondary “consolation bracket” or assign them the crucial roles of game referees and official scorekeepers. This keeps the collective energy high and ensures that no one spends the evening sitting on the sidelines feeling left out.

Cozy Collaborative Escapes and Mystery NightsIf intense competition does not suit your group’s dynamic, shift the focus toward teamwork with cooperative games. Winter provides the perfect backdrop for immersive, narrative-driven experiences. Escape room kits in a box or murder mystery party games allow your entire group to unite against a common challenge. These games naturally encourage deep conversation, collective problem-solving, and plenty of shared laughter as players decode puzzles, analyze clues, and piece together complex storylines.You can maximize the immersion by matching your physical environment to the theme of the game. If you are solving a mystery set in a snowy Victorian manor, dim the overhead lights and rely on candlelight or the glow of a fireplace. Play a soft, atmospheric instrumental playlist in the background to build subtle tension. Encourage your guests to dress up according to the game’s era or theme, turning a simple evening into a memorable night of theatrical fun.

High-Energy Interactive Party GamesWhen the winter blues set in, a high-energy party game is the ultimate antidote to inject laughter and movement into the room. Games that require physical acting, quick drawing, or rapid verbal responses are ideal for larger groups. Classics like charades, Pictionary, or modern smartphone-integrated trivia games break the ice instantly. These formats break down social barriers and get people moving, which is a fantastic way to generate physical warmth and lively energy on a freezing night.To keep the momentum going, divide your guests into teams right as they arrive. Keep the rounds short, fast, and punchy to prevent any dips in the room’s enthusiasm. You can customize the trivia questions or charade prompts to feature winter themes, such as famous snowy movies, winter sports, or historical cold-weather expeditions. The fast pace guarantees that the room stays filled with cheers, friendly banter, and constant movement.

Nostalgic Childhood Classics ReimaginedTap into the comforting feelings of winter nostalgia by reviving the games of your youth with a mature, creative twist. Introduce oversized versions of childhood favorites, or add custom rules to traditional games like musical chairs, hide-and-seek, or vintage video game tournaments. Revisit retro console games that support multiplayer formats, allowing four or more players to compete in whimsical racing or sports games that trigger fond memories.Uproarious laughter naturally follows when adults attempt to navigate the simple rules of childhood games with newfound competitive spirits. You can pair these nostalgic activities with a menu of elevated childhood comfort foods. Serve a gourmet grilled cheese station, artisanal sliders, or a DIY hot cocoa bar complete with crushed peppermint, marshmallows, and cinnamon sticks to reinforce the warm, sentimental theme of the evening.

Curating the Ultimate Winter AmbienceThe success of a winter game night depends heavily on the comfort of the environment you create. Transforming a standard living room into a sanctuary from the cold requires careful attention to lighting, seating, and temperature. Layer the room with extra throw blankets, oversized floor pillows, and plush cushions so that everyone can lounge comfortably during long gaming sessions. Rely on warm, soft lighting from lamps and fairy lights rather than harsh overhead fixtures to create an inviting, intimate space.Food and drink should be easily accessible and minimal mess. Opt for finger foods, slow-cooker dips, and warm appetizers that can remain heated throughout the night without requiring constant trips to the kitchen. Providing a mix of warm beverages like spiced cider, herbal teas, and seasonal punches keeps guests cozy from the inside out, allowing the entire group to focus completely on the joy of play, connection, and community until the snow melts outside.
